The primary advantage of the heap-leach method is that it preserves the environmental conditions of the area. By choosing heap leach, mining and processing can continue while protecting the environment and natural resources. Pastures and adjacent areas are not affected by extraction operations.
Because the sodium cyanide solution is used in a closed-loop heap-leach cycle (storage pond, heap, drainage system, storage pond), any contamination of surface and ground water is ruled out. The environment inside and adjacent to the site and plant is monitored by the company's environmental services team.
The environmental assessment of the area has also been submitted to the National Department of Environment, and a clearance permitting mining operations and plant production has been obtained.
